    Everyone needs to realize that things are gonna turn out the way they’re gonna turn out, no matter what. Believe me, I want that #1 pick as much as everyone else, but just let the season play out and that’s it. There’s too much analysis and thought going into something that none of us have any control over. If we finish 29th instead of 30th, so be it. We still have a good shot at the #1 pick if that’s the case. Finishing 30th actually hasn’t worked out well for that team since the inception of the draft lottery. I think the stat is that out of 13 lotteries that have taken place, the 30th team has only retained that #1 pick 5 times. That’s less than 50% of the time. So let’s just let things happen as they may. If we finish 30th, then great. We’d be guaranteed JT or Hedman. If we finish 29th, we’d probably still get one of those two and still could end up with the #1 pick. Lets Go Isles!
